The International Olympic Committee (IOC) announced (Olympics LA28 Los Angeles Cricket Flag Football Lacrosse Squash Baseball) the addition of five new sports to the schedule for the 2028 Summer Olympics in Los Angeles. These sports, which will make their Olympic debut or return after a long absence, are flag football, squash, cricket (specifically T20 variation), lacrosse (played as sixes), and baseball-softball. The decision was made in alignment with American sports culture and aims to attract new viewers while showcasing iconic American sports to the world.

Cricket (T20 Variation): Cricket, a massively popular sport in India, is making its return to the Olympics after last being played in 1900. The T20 format, known for its fast-paced, three-hour matches, will be featured in the 2028 Games.

Lacrosse (Sixes Variation): Lacrosse, with its Indigenous North American roots, will be played in the sixes variation, a fast-paced version developed in 2018. Lacrosse was previously contested in the 1904 and 1908 Olympics and appeared as a demonstration sport in 1948.

Flag Football: A non-contact version of American football, flag football is popular among children in the U.S. The addition of flag football was influenced by a campaign by the NFL, highlighting its widespread participation among youngsters.

Squash: Played by 20 million players across 180 countries, squash will finally be featured in the Olympics after previous attempts failed. The sport's unique glass-walled courts allow for innovative venue setups, such as placing courts at iconic locations like the foot of the pyramids or Grand Central Station.

Baseball-Softball: Although not entirely new to the Olympics, baseball and softball are returning after a hiatus. They were last played at the Tokyo Olympics in 2021 and were not part of the lineup for the upcoming Paris Games in 2024.

These additions aim to make the Olympic Games in Los Angeles unique by incorporating sports that reflect both American culture and global appeal. The inclusion of these sports is expected to enhance the diversity and excitement of the Olympic program, drawing in a broader audience.
